The former Kayserispor player, Ghanaian footballer Asamoah Gyan, claimed that Victor Osimhen's injury before the Champions League was planned. The Nigerian star Osimhen had been injured during the World Cup African Qualifiers. Gyan suggested that Osimhen's injury might have been orchestrated to ensure he would be fit for the Champions League match.

Before the Champions League work at Galatasaray, Victor Osimhen's injury became a topic of discussion. Former Kayserispor player Ghanaian footballer Asamoah Gyan claimed that Victor Osimhen's injury before the Champions League was planned.

INJURED IN NATIONAL MATCH

The Nigerian star could not continue the game against Rwanda in the 2026 World Cup African Qualifiers, and his condition became clear after an MRI. It is expected that Osimhen will not play against Eyüpspor on Saturday, but he is expected to play in the away match against Frankfurt.

ALLEGATION: PLANNED INJURY

Following the events, former Kayserispor player Ghanaian footballer Asamoah Gyan made striking claims about Osimhen. Gyan alleged that Osimhen's injury might have been planned so that he could be fit for the Champions League match.

"I KNOW THESE TRICKS"

Gyan stated, "I know these tricks. Someone told him, 'Look, we spent a lot of money on you. The Champions League is coming. We don't like you going to Africa during the national team break, but play a little there, lie on the ground and act serious, and you'll be in Turkey the next day.'"

The former Ghanaian footballer also said, "Believe me, you will see him running fit in the Turkish Super League and the Champions League. No matter how many kicks they give him there, he won't lie on the ground. The doctors are also involved. Euro is more important than Naira," he said.
